What is the best tennis movie of all time?
Two of these were shot as thrillers and one is a Hitchcock. The sport keeps turning out to be about something else.
1King RichardThe 2021 film about Richard Williams coaching Venus and Serena, which won Will Smith the Best Actor Oscar.1000pts
2ChallengersLuca Guadagnino's 2024 love triangle set around a Challenger-level tournament, scored by Reznor and Ross.908pts
3WimbledonA 2004 romantic comedy with Paul Bettany as a British journeyman given a wild card into his last tournament.735pts
4Pat and MikeThe 1952 Tracy-Hepburn comedy in which Hepburn plays an athlete and Gussie Moran appears as herself.647pts
5Match PointWoody Allen's 2005 thriller about a retired tennis pro, opening on a ball hanging on the net cord.647pts
6Venus and SerenaA 2012 documentary that followed both sisters through a single season, injuries and all.483pts
7Strangers on a TrainHitchcock's 1951 thriller, whose protagonist is a tennis player and whose tennis-match sequence is a set piece.381pts
8Battle of the SexesThe 2017 account of King and Riggs in 1973, with Emma Stone and Steve Carell in the leads.381pts
9Borg vs McEnroeA 2017 drama about the 1980 Wimbledon final, with Shia LaBeouf as McEnroe.260pts
10UnstrungA 2003 documentary following seven of America's top junior players through a season on the national circuit.260pts
11Gods of TennisA 2023 BBC documentary series on the 1970s and 1980s, built around Wimbledon and the players who changed it.114pts
